Any day with a ring can't be all bad.

I think I'm beginning to like hunting places where there's a lot of variety in the finds. You know like a modern school where the ground had been a farm, so the possibility of old is always there. But, all the modern action keeps the clad well stocked, even some jewelry.

You're pretty sure what the target is going to be but there are those nice little surprises that keeps this hobby fun. Sure, I would rather have my variety center around years before 1900, but can't have everything huh. ;)

Anyway, tried a new school grounds today. Here's the take:
